With all things COVID, many of us in the Motorsports community turned to Virtual Racing. Watching your heroes battle it out, crash and bash, and even rage quit on iRacing – weekend after weekend. But in the GTM world, that’s just another Tuesday night. What you might not realize is that as a club, GTM has been holding Virtual Racing League (VRL) events since 2016. (Check out other series recaps we’ve released over the years).

Taking into account everything that’s come before, Series 12 was something special, the committee has been planning it for quite some time, and released it under a bit of duress. With everyone sheltering in place, it was the perfect time to launch what they though might be “the perfect series.” The team even put together a trailer (below) to set the mood for S12.

All jokes aside, when the flags dropped … S12 did exactly what it was designed to do: create competition that was pretty intense. Having designed a whole new set of rules leveraging an in-game based penalty system, leveling the vehicle field made for some really exciting racing. As seen (below) in the recap of Opening Night.

After the initial chaos of starting a “new series” drivers really settled into a rhythm – flipping and flopping between Spec Miata’s and Formula Mazda’s paired with short/long tracks (often at the same venue) proved fun and also challenging. Overall the season was hard fought, with lots of position changes during the race, as well as on the leaderboards and standings. The NASCAR IROC exhibition races were a great way to break up the series and earn some extra points. #slingshotengaged #shakeandbake. The Finale

What would a series be without some sort of GRAND FINALE?!? Traditionally, all VRLs up through No.11 have ended at Road Atlanta. But this time, the committee figured VIR was the perfect place to have a final showdown in our Spec Mazdas. It allowed us to have a double SSM race on South and Patroit Course, and a no holds barre showdown on the Full Course in FMs. Check out the Recap video (below).

Looking back, maybe not much changed from opening night but S12 helped unite us, break up the week, and get us through the last couple of months! – In the end, our multi-tasking mad man… Jordan F took a his second VRL Championship, and the overall S12 victory with a record 210 points.
